Problems installing QNX 6.1.0

Hi.

Help needed!

I’ve got a 700 Mhz K7 system, with an AGP Rage FuryMax card. Everything goes well until the installation process shows a graphical window prompting me to indicate the video adapter (I choose rage128), the resolution (I choose 1024x768) and the frequency of the monitor (I choose 60). Then I click the “test” button and the monitor only shows garbage. After that the only thing I can do is reset the pc.

I’ve tried other configurations (800x600 with other frequencies), but nothing works.

Some ideas? Thank you all!!

Hi again.

I’ve solved the problem using the vesa video adapter. Easy. :slight_smile:

Maybe then ATI Rage FuryMax video card is not full supported by QNX.

Hi Jordi,

The ATI Rage FuryMax is not supported. It has dual-Rage128 chips on
it. The devg-ati_rage128.so only supports cards with 1 Rage128
graphics chip on it.
